Abstract:
Intraperitoneal sporadic tumor is a common and complicated syndrome in cancers, causing a high rate of death, and people find that intraperitoneal chemotherapy (IPC) can treat intraperitoneal sporadic tumors better than intravenous chemotherapy and surgery. However, the effectiveness and side effects of IPC are controversial, and the operation process of IPC is complicated. Herein, the injectable paclitaxel-loaded (PTX-loaded) electrospun short fibers are constructed through a series process of electrospinning, homogenizing, crosslinking, and subsequent polydopamine coating and folate acid (FA) modification. The evenly dispersed short fibers exhibited effective tumor cell killing and good injectable ability, which is convenient to use and greatly improved the complex operation procedure. Mussel-like protein poly-dopamine coating and FA modification endowed short fibers with the ability of targeted adhesion to tumors, and therefore the short fibers further acted as a kind of micro membrane that could release drugs to tumors at close range, maintaining local high drug concentration and prevent paclitaxel killing normal tissues. Thus, the target-adhesive injectable electrospun short fibers are expected to be the potential candidate for cancer treatment, especially the intraperitoneal sporadic tumors, which are hard to treat by surgery or intravenous chemotherapy.
摘要:
腹膜内散发性肿瘤是癌症中常见且复杂的综合征,导致高死亡率,人们发现腹腔化疗(IPC)比静脉化疗和手术治疗腹腔内散发性肿瘤更好。然而,IPC的有效性和副作用是有争议的,IPC的操作过程复杂。在这里,通过一系列静电纺丝工艺构建了可注射的载紫杉醇(PTX)电纺短纤维,均质化,交联,以及随后的聚多巴胺涂层和叶酸(FA)改性。均匀分散的短纤维显示出有效的肿瘤细胞杀伤和良好的注射能力,使用方便,大大提高了复杂的操作程序。贻贝类蛋白聚多巴胺涂层和FA修饰赋予短纤维靶向粘附肿瘤的能力,因此,短纤维进一步充当一种微膜,可以向肿瘤近距离释放药物,维持局部高药物浓度,防止紫杉醇杀死正常组织。因此,靶向粘合剂可注射电纺短纤维有望成为癌症治疗的潜在候选者,尤其是腹膜内散发的肿瘤,很难通过手术或静脉化疗来治疗。
